Transaction 839a27a1c25cbdcecc2a29c433910721f167cc0559d6f287715b67c091bc28e4
1 Input
1 Output
-
839a27a1c25cbdcecc2a29c433910721f167cc0559d6f287715b67c091bc28e4:0
- value
- 17466412
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a8c94a18ad81ccf0aa128fe1a74d5136f6bb536
- address
- bc1q82xffgv2mqwv7z4p9rlp5ax4zdhkhdfkwxwr62